Aims, contents and method of the course

Gymnastik: Rhythmisches Bewegen mit und Handgerät, mit und ohne Musik; Bodypercussion; Richtungen des Aerobic-Trainings (Fitness, Dance);
Tanz: Tradierte Richtungen mit Technikbasis (Modern und Moderner Tanz, Afrikanischer und Lateinamerikanischer Tanz, Jazzdance, Streetdance, Hip Hop); VideoClip Dance; Ausdruckstanz; Tanzimprovisation; Zeitgenössisch; Bewegungs-, Tanz-, Sporttheater; Showdance; Musical Dance; Pantomime; Cross-Over-Sport in Verbindung mit Tanz; kurzzeitige jugendorientierte Tanzweisen;

Assessment and permitted materials

Active participation in the course (min.75%)
Solo and group performance
Small presentation on a specific topic
presentation with a specific focus

Minimum requirements and assessment criteria

Students:
can handle the basic forms of gymnastics with and without handset and
vary the techniques they have learned, can combine and transfer them to non-traditional handsets,
can release their creativity by experimenting with a variety of objects and materials and through an expanded vocabulary of movement
can create solo and group pieces by using the techniques they have learned and by exploiting their creative potential.
can perceive the quality of movement in the field of gymnastics and dance (flow of movement, tension, relaxation) and use sensory feedback.
have an adequate level of demonstration and performance in the field of gymnastics and dance to make short teaching sequences and writing.
